About Putt-Putt® Joins the Circus
Step Right Up!
Discover the Circus with Putt-Putt®!
B.J. Sweeney needs you and Putt-Putt® to help his five main acts get ready for the show. They will encounter challenges and have fun at the same time.
Junior Adventures challenge and inspires kids to observe details and solve problems in creative and flexible ways. Kids play with faithful lovable friends as they discover and explore captivating worlds where they direct the journey at their own pace.
Product Features
- Problem Solving, Uh-oh! What goes into a power shake? Ivan the Semi-Strong Van can barely lift his antenna until his recipe card is pieced together.
- Kindness, Splash! Putt-Putt® gladly patches Francine the high-diving hippo's swimming pool.
- Teamwork, Phew! Thanks Putt-Putt®. With the larger umbrella Eunice can safely cross the high wire.
- Friendship, Tra La! Sing under the big big top with your new circus friends!

Players appreciate this Putt Putt game for its fun gameplay, solid technical performance, and nostalgic charm, with many enjoying the circus setting and character interactions. However, some feel it's a weaker entry in the series compared to earlier games, particularly due to the removal of item randomization which made previous titles more replayable, and note that while it's enjoyable on a first playthrough, it doesn't have the same lasting appeal as other entries.
